Output 29d36d5d6c5926f10ebfa60651994177d5a5049d3016c573476a3143758d3b4f:0

value
20905045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2629e48b35a731c44bc575f64361cdaa6ef890e2 OP_EQUAL
address
MBNx6UjZSNPmazxvYEmtuByQVXoh7N67oH
transaction
29d36d5d6c5926f10ebfa60651994177d5a5049d3016c573476a3143758d3b4f
spent
true